The X Factor viewers were sent into a tizzy on Sunday night when it appeared that Matt Terry and Freddy Parker kissed following his win. The kiss appeared to justify months of speculation that the two were a couple.

Fans of the show were convinced they had seen the pair lock lips, with one tweeting:

"Very glad #MattTerry won #XFactor well deserved and did I see him kiss @FreddyParker98 at the end I do hope so!!"

Another added: "Matt and Freddy are definitely a couple, after that hug from behind and that kiss! #xfactorfinal #XFactor #XFactorUK2016 #mattterry"

Alas, the romance was all in our heads as Matt Terry told Dan Wootton for The Sun:

"I don’t know what this is about. Freddy is my little brother, we hit it off straight away. Since day one, we are just bros man. We have such a bromance going – no relationship I’m afraid guys, I’m sorry to say. Sorry man."

He then joked: "No I don’t think we kissed but he would have been lucky if I did."

Despite denying a romance with Freddy, Matt wasn’t so shy about another possible X Factor crush. After Nicole Scherzinger planted a huge kiss on him, he revealed he wasn’t in any rush to wash off her lipstick stains. He said:

"Do you know who did give me a big kiss? I had a big red lipstick from Nicole. The Four of Diamond girls were saying 'You’ve got make up on’ and I was like 'No please leave it on there.'"
